Ticket: TURN-4471 — GateCount prod credentials expired

The Ashvale Arena turnstile counter stopped reporting at 02:10; root cause is the expired service credential for the internal TallyCore aggregator. Counts are queuing locally on the gate controllers, so no data loss yet, but buffers fill in ~36 hours. Patch swaps the dead credential and adds expiry alerting at 14 days. Please review the client init change. Replacement credential for TallyCore is the key below.

gateway credential: kto3_qfe

To: release channel
Subject: Pickwise optimizer — rollout status

Pickwise pick-list optimizer v3 cut is staged. Aisle-clustering regression from last cycle is fixed; verified against the Dunmore warehouse replay set. Throughput up 4% in sim. Canary goes to one site tomorrow morning; full rollout Thursday if error budget holds. No schema changes this cycle. Flag rollback is one toggle. Approve against the build token below.

session token of hawif-bajog = htk6_9ab8da

# Queueflow Environments

Welcome aboard! We recently swapped out our homegrown job queue (the infamous "Grindstone") for Queueflow across all three environments: dev, staging, and prod. Dev resets nightly, staging mirrors prod weekly, and prod is hands-off without a ticket. Before touching anything, skim the env-specific settings. Here are the staging configuration values you'll need.

settings of yaguf-bahip:
druwyn:
  log_level: debug
  metrics_host: metrics.druwyn.qorvelsys.internal
  pool_size: 32

## Changelog — PeriodWeaver v2.4

Heads up, new folks: we renamed `SOLVER_KEY` to `TIMETABLE_SOLVER_SECRET` because the old name kept confusing people with the license key. The timetable solver won't boot without it, so update your local env file. Add the new variable on the line right after this sentence.

vault entry, kafog-yahop: COURIER_KEY8=0faa53ae